WebRead this extract from Toast: The Story of a Boy’s Hunger – a memoir written by Nigel Slater, a famous chef – in which he discusses his memories of his mother and … WebThis moving memoir delves in Nigel Slater’s memories of childhood and his early love for food as well as the intimate workings of his family and their relationships as well as his own awareness of his sexual identity and the common aspects of growing up as a childhood in England in the sixties.
WebSlater succeeds not only in capturing the joyfulness, grief, and helplessness of a young boy, but also the impossibly vivid sensation of new experiences in food, sex, and family love in adulthood. Each chapter is named for a certain type of food, and in them he moves the lens from whatever was eaten to whatever was said, done, and felt. WebThe book did seem that way at first. It is evocative, humorous, and deeply rooted in place and time, with architectural details and brand names placing it firmly in middle …
